The iHeart Music Awards went down last night…did you notice?  Well, Jelly Roll was named Country Artist of the Year.  The other nominees in the category were Kane Brown . . . Lainey Wilson . . . Chris Stapleton . . . Luke Combs . . . and Morgan Wallen.

The latest Blake Lively – Justin Baldoni’s legal drama has now pulled in ANOTHER person…Hugh Jackman.  Jackman, who starred with Reynolds in Deadpool, is expected to speak about Reynolds’ behavior. A source says,  “Hugh will be deposed if this goes to trial. There is no way that he cannot.”

Kip Moore says he doesn’t agree with all of the collaborations in between genres that go on at country music awards shows.  He said, “Nick Jonas, just because he’s on the show . . . his fans aren’t gonna tune in, and the people that really love country are gonna say, ‘What is this?’ and then turn it off.”

The NY Post says Tracy Morgan was taken out of Madison Square Garden last night in a wheelchair after losing his lunch in his courtside seats. He became ill during the Knicks game. Morgan was hunched over and bleeding from the nose. The incident caused a brief delay in the game.

Diddy is allegedly gearing up for a one-billion-dollar legal smackdown against Netflix over the docuseries Sean Combs: The Reckoning. His camp says there’s unauthorized personal footage in the series. The director fired back saying the footage came to them legally, with full rights, and added that Diddy has basically filmed himself obsessively for decades. She also says they repeatedly asked his legal team for comment and heard… nothing. I’ve watched it and let’s just say, this lawsuit is gonna need popcorn. We with him all the luck.

The lineup is out for New Year’s Eve Live: Nashville’s Big Bash and it is stacked. Lainey Wilson, Zach Top, Riley Green, Megan Moroney, and a whole parade of country hitmakers are ringing in the new year.
